Boeing Completes Destructive Testing on 787 Dreamliner Wing Box
SEATTLE, Nov. 15 /PRNewswire-FirstCall/ — Boeing (NYSE: BA) completed destructive testing today on a full-scale composite wing box of the 787 Dreamliner, the first all-composite wing box ever built for a Boeing commercial airplane. This test is part of the certification process for the all-new jetliner.
“Successful completion of the wing box destruction test marks a major step forward in highlighting the innovation on the 787,” said Mark Jenks, vice president of 787 Development. “In addition to determining the strength of the structure, the test helps us verify the analytical methods we have used to calculate the loads the structure will have to carry.”
